Chaplin Community Park is a vibrant outdoor destination located on Hilton Head Island, South Carolina. Situated between Burkes Beach Road and Singleton Beach, it offers a diverse range of activities and amenities for both locals and visitors. The park spans 111 acres, providing ample space for sports, picnics, and relaxation amidst beautiful natural surroundings. It features basketball and tennis courts, a playground, a dog park, and direct beach access, making it an ideal spot for families and outdoor enthusiasts. The park's scenic trails allow visitors to explore the marshlands and coastal areas, offering opportunities to spot local wildlife and enjoy the island's natural beauty.
The park's beach access is less crowded than some of the island's more popular spots, providing a quieter and more serene experience for those looking to enjoy the Atlantic Ocean. With picnic pavilions and grills available, it's perfect for family gatherings or casual barbecues. The park's commitment to environmental conservation adds to its appeal, preserving the island's natural habitats and promoting sustainability.
